For selected cargo securement projects, lashlokscm is designed to help buyers review key production milestones, quality records, loading photos, and shipment documentation in a more structured way.

In industrial cargo securement projects, the real risk is often not the product itself. It is the gap between order confirmation, production progress, quality checks, loading records, and final shipment documentation.
lashlokscm is being developed to organize these project records into a clearer visibility layer, so buyers can review what has been confirmed, what has been checked, and what documentation is available before shipment.
Better visibility does not replace project management. It helps make project management easier to verify.

What Buyers Can Review Through the Visibility Workflow
Production Milestones
Review key project stages such as order confirmation, sample approval, production start, inspection arrangement, loading, and shipment document preparation.
QC Records
Keep inspection reports, measurement checks, issue records, and approval notes organized by project when available.
Loading Photos
Review loading photos and container records before final shipment confirmation for qualifying orders.
Shipment Documents
Access packing lists, container numbers, seal numbers, invoice copies, and bill of lading references when the order reaches shipment stage.
Issue Follow-up Records
Track documented issue notes, corrective action status, and follow-up records when a quality or delivery issue is reported.
From Order Confirmation to Shipment Documentation
How project records are organized and made visible through the lashlokscm visibility workflow.
Project Setup
LashLok creates a structured project record after order or custom project brief is confirmed.
Milestone Updates
Key stages are updated based on project progress, production schedule, and inspection arrangement.
QC Record Upload
Inspection reports, measurement records, product photos, and issue notes are organized when available.
Loading & Shipment Records
Loading photos, packing list, container and seal numbers, and shipment documents are linked.
Account Manager Follow-up
LashLok account managers continue to coordinate communication and confirm next steps directly.
Visibility Support, Not a Replacement for Quality Control
lashlokscm is designed as a communication and documentation support layer. Final quality confirmation still depends on inspection reports, documented approvals, and direct project management by the LashLok team.
This System Does Not Replace
Account manager communication
Pre-shipment inspection reports
Signed sample or specification approvals
Official shipment documents
